Qualities that make a breed excellent for psychiatric service work include a calm demeanor, a strong work drive, and an eagerness to please. Intelligence is also a must – psychiatric service dogs need to learn how to perform several tasks, many of which are complex in nature. ... WebHowever, you can generally expect a service dog to cost anywhere between $10,000 and $50,000. Service dogs undergo training for up to two years. During that time, they require food, housing, and veterinary care just like any other dog. On top of that, the dogs’ trainers need to get paid for their time.
